NEW VARIFOCAL LENSES DESIGNED FOR HIGH END SURVEILLANCE Kowa Introduces New Day & Night Lenses for Ultra High Resolution Applications
Los Angeles, CA — Kowa announces a new series of Day & Night lenses with advanced optical innovations deigned to set the standard in varifocal CCTV lenses. These lenses are ideal for highway surveillance to read vehicle license plates traveling at a high rate of speed or for other security related applications. “By using high grade XD (eXtra low Dispersion) glass, our lenses provide crisp color images in the daylight and high definition black and white images at night without the need for refocusing,” says Andrew Kam, Sales Consultant of Kowa Optimed, Inc. “The LMVZ9020-IR and LMVZ3510-IR lenses provide multi-megapixel resolution, reduce chromatic aberration, and minimize distortion."
Kowa’s new Day & Night lenses also feature a Dual-Sided Aspherical lens. In conjunction with XD glass, this new advanced optical design easily corrects chromatic aberrations for high contrast and image clarity. Aspherical lenses are highly effective in the elimination of not only spherical aberration, but also other forms of aberration inherently generated by conventional spherical lenses.
The LMVZ9020-IR and LMVZ3510-IR lenses are available through Kowa’s network of authorized dealers. The new lenses offer focal lengths of 9-20mm and 3.5-10mm respectively. Both lenses have a CS-Mount, a ½” lens format, and an F-stop value of F/1.6. In addition, auto-iris versions of the two lenses are available.
Kowa Announces the Release of their New 5 Plus Megapixel JC5M Series
Los Angeles, CA – Kowa Optimed, Inc., a leading innovator in optical technology, is proud to announce the unveiling of their new 5 megapixel JC5m series camera lenses. The JC5M lenses are engineered for a variety of applications where monitoring critical details is essential, making its superior level of clarity and high-resolution capabilities perfect for industrial FA, machine vision, and surveillance systems. The JC5M series lenses feature an advanced optical system with focal lengths ranging from 12.5mm – 35mm, delivering sharp video quality and minimizing image distortion (between 0.01 – 0.06%).
Each lens incorporates Kowa’s floating mechanism design, which enables the lens to achieve optimum optical performance at various objective distances. In addition to improving the overall clarity of the images, Kowa has also increased the resolution of the lenses to 160 lp/mm at both the center and corner, allowing for high corner brightness and contrast.
Kowa is introducing four JC5M lenses: the 12.5mm LM12JC5M, the 16mm LM16JC5M, the 25mm LM25JC5M, and the 35mm LM35JC5M. the C-Mount lenses are manually adjusted, giving the user complete control over focus and iris settings. JC5M lens series not only helps to achieve optimal clarity, but also eliminates color distortion to produce picture perfect images. The LM12JC5M and LM16JC5M have an MSRP price of $1,290.00 while the LM25JC5M and LM35JC5M have an MSRP price of $1,230.00.

Next Generation of Applications are Moving to Color Cameras and Lenses Kowa Introduces First F-Mount 3CCD Color Line Scan Lens in the Industry
Kowa, already the forerunner in high performance Industrial FA, Machine Vision and Security Lenses, has just pushed the envelope of color imaging capability with two advanced 3CCD Color Line Scan Lenses.
Kowa has introduced the LM50CLS and the LM28CLS 3CCD color line-scan lenses. The new lenses offer focal lengths that are 50mm and 28mm, respectively, iris range for both is 2.8 to 16, and minimum focus distance is 0.5m. The lenses have 30mm sensor coverage and a Nikon F-mount. The front filter screw size is M52 X 0.75 for the LM50CLS and M72 X 0.75 for the LM28CLS and the maximum diameter (ratio) is f/2.8.
Industry professionals who have tested the new 3CCD Color Line Lenses were not only amazed at the enhanced resolution, but also at how smoothly and effortlessly they operated in the factory environment. According to Joshua Lazenby, Channel Manager of Kowa Optimed, system integrators are elated about having the ability to offer the first F-mount 3CCD Line Scan Lens with these performance specifications as part of their integrated solution. “In evolving to color vision applications, the ability to produce consistent, low noise, high resolution images becomes much more critical,” Lazenby notes. “Kowa has developed the new lenses to provide ultra high resolution, low color aberration and maximize high corner brightness.”
There is a broad spectrum of applications where the ability to identify and match colors is critical. Assembly processes often require color matching to create products offered in a wide range of colors. As an example, pharmaceutical identification and inspection is often keyed to color and in processed food production, color change is an indication of the stage or condition of the processed material. A critical factor in optimizing system performance is the selection of the proper lens for the application. In Many Multi-chip cameras the presence of a prism introduces chromatic and spherical aberrations. The advanced optical design of the new lenses compensates for these characteristics by providing low color aberration and high quality images.

New Varifocal Lenses Designed for Large Scale Security Applications
Kowa Introduces Day & Night Lenses with Advanced Optical Technology
Kowa announces a new series of Day & Night Lenses with advanced optical innovations designed to set the standard in Varifocal CCTV lenses. These next generation Day & Night Lenses are ideally suited for the requirements of large installations within the commercial government and healthcare sectors.
Kowa has introduced the LMVZ38A-IR and the LMVZ990A-IR Day & Night Varifocal lenses which are available through our network of authorized dealers. The new lenses offer focal lengths 3-8mm and 9-90mm, respectively, iris range is 1.0 to 360 for the LMVZ38A-IR and 1.8 to 360 for the LMVZ990A-IR. Both lenses are compact and have ED (extra-low dispersion) Glass. The format size is 1/3” for the LMVZ38A-IR and ½” for the LMVZ990A-IR.
Kowa’s new Day & Night LMVZ38A-IR adopts a Dual-Sided Aspherical lens. In conjunction with ED glass, this new advanced optical design easily corrects aberrations for high contrast and image clarity. Aspherical lenses compensate for spherical aberration by using only one lens. “This is done by controlling the refraction of incoming light rays from the optical axis by changing the curvature of the lens and moving it toward the light direction of the optical axis,” states Joshua Lazenby, Channel Manager of Kowa Optimed, Inc. “Aspherical lenses are highly effective in the elimination of not only spherical aberration, but also other forms of aberration inherently generated by conventional spherical lenses.”
For applications requiring long range surveillance, the new LMVZ990A-IR has the largest focal range of Day & Night Varifocal lens in the industry. This product was specifically designed for applications such as highway surveillance to read vehicle license plates traveling at a high rate of speed or for other long range monitoring needs. "By using high grade ED glass, our lenses provide crisp color images in the daylight and high definition black and white images at night without the need of refocusing," says Lazenby.
